Shape and Reflectance from RGB-D Images using Time Sequential Illumination

Matis Hudon, Adrien Gruson, Paul Kerbiriou, Rémi Cozot, Kadi Bouatouch



In this paper we propose a method for recovering the shape (geometry) and the diffuse reflectance from an image (or video) using a hybrid setup consisting of a depth sensor (Kinect), a consumer camera and a partially controlled illumination (using a flash). The objective is to show how combining RGB-D acquisition with a sequential illumination is useful for shape and reflectance recovery. A pair of two images are captured: one non flashed (image under ambient illumination) and a flashed one. A pure flash image is computed by subtracting the non flashed image from the flashed image. We propose an novel and near real-time algorithm, based on a local illumination model of our flash and the pure flash image, to enhance geometry (from the noisy depth map) and recover reflectance information.


  1. Bruckstein, A. M. (1988). On shape from shading. Computer Vision, Graphics, and Image Processing, 44(2):139-154.
  2. de Decker, B., Kautz, J., Mertens, T., and Bekaert, P. (2009). Capturing multiple illumination conditions using time and color multiplexing. In 2009 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R 2009), 20-25 June 2009, Miami, Florida, USA, pages 2536-2543.
  3. Debevec, P. (2012). The light stages and their applications to photoreal digital actors. SIGGRAPH Asia Technical Briefs.
  4. DiCarlo, J. M., Xiao, F., and Wandell, B. A. (2001). Illuminating illumination. In Color and Imaging Conference, volume 2001, pages 27-34. Society for Imaging Science and Technology.
  5. Diebel, J. and Thrun, S. (2005). An application of markov random fields to range sensing. InAdvances in neural information processing systems, pages 291-298.
  6. Fanello, S. R., Keskin, C., Izadi, S., Kohli, P., Kim, D., Sweeney, D., Criminisi, A., Shotton, J., Kang, S. B., and Paek, T. (2014). Learning to be a depth camera for close-range human capture and interaction. ACM Transactions on Graphics (TOG), 33(4):86.
  7. Hernández, C., Vogiatzis, G., Brostow, G. J., Stenger, B., and Cipolla, R. (2007). Non-rigid photometric stereo with colored lights. In ICCV.
  8. Higo, T., Matsushita, Y., and Ikeuchi, K. (2010). Consensus photometric stereo. In Computer Vision and Pattern Recognition (CVPR), 2010 IEEE Conference on, pages 1157-1164. IEEE.
  9. Horn, B. K. (1970). Shape from shading: A method for obtaining the shape of a smooth opaque object from one view.
  10. Horn, B. K. and Brooks, M. J. (1989). Shape from shading. MIT press.
  11. Kim, H., Wilburn, B., and Ben-Ezra, M. (2010). Photometric stereo for dynamic surface orientations. In Computer Vision - ECCV 2010, 11th European Conference on Computer Vision, Heraklion, Crete, Greece, September 5-11, 2010, Proceedings, Part I, pages 59- 72.
  12. Nehab, D., Rusinkiewicz, S., Davis, J., and Ramamoorthi, R. (2005). Efficiently combining positions and normals for precise 3d geometry. ACM transactions on graphics (TOG), 24(3):536-543.
  13. Newcombe, R. A., Fox, D., and Seitz, S. M. (2015). Dynamicfusion: Reconstruction and tracking of nonrigid scenes in real-time.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 343-352.
  14. Or-El, R., Rosman, G., Wetzler, A., Kimmel, R., and Bruckstein, A. M. (2015). Rgbd-fusion: Real-time high precision depth recovery.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pages 5407-5416.
  15. Petschnigg, G., Szeliski, R., Agrawala, M., Cohen, M., Hoppe, H., and Toyama, K. (2004). Digital photography with flash and no-flash image pairs. ACM transactions on graphics (TOG), 23(3):664-672.
  16. Prados, E. and Faugeras, O. (2005). Shape from shading: a well-posed problem? In Computer Vision and Pattern Recognition, 2005. CVPR 2005. IEEE Computer Society Conference on, volume 2, pages 870-877. IEEE.
  17. Richardt, C., Stoll, C., Dodgson, N. A., Seidel, H.-P., and Theobalt, C. (2012). Coherent spatiotemporal filtering, upsampling and rendering of rgbz videos. In Computer Graphics Forum, volume 31, pages 247- 256. Wiley Online Library.
  18. Shen, L., Tan, P., and Lin, S. (2008). Intrinsic image decomposition with non-local texture cues. In Computer Vision and Pattern Recognition, 2008. CVPR 2008. IEEE Conference on, pages 1-7. IEEE.
  19. Shen, L. and Yeo, C. (2011). Intrinsic images decomposition using a local and global sparse representation of reflectance. In Computer Vision and Pattern Recognition (CVPR), 2011 IEEE Conference on, pages 697- 704. IEEE.
  20. Tunwattanapong, B., Fyffe, G., Graham, P., Busch, J., Yu, X., Ghosh, A., and Debevec, P. (2013). Acquiring reflectance and shape from continuous spherical harmonic illumination. ACM Transactions on graphics (TOG), 32(4):109.
  21. Wenger, A., Gardner, A., Tchou, C., Unger, J., Hawkins, T., and Debevec, P. (2005). Performance relighting and reflectance transformation with time-multiplexed illumination. 24(3):756-764.
  22. Woodham, R. J. (1980). Photometric method for determining surface orientation from multiple images. Optical Engineering, 19(1):191139-191139-.
  23. Wu, C., Zollhöfer, M., Nießner, M., Stamminger, M., Izadi, S., and Theobalt, C. (2014). Real-time shading-based refinement for consumer depth cameras. Proc. SIGGRAPH Asia.
  24. Xiao, F., DiCarlo, J. M., Catrysse, P. B., and Wandell, B. A. (2001). Image analysis using modulated light sources. In Photonics West 2001-Electronic Imaging, pages 22-30. International Society for Optics and Photonics.

Paper Citation

in Harvard Style

Hudon M., Gruson A., Kerbiriou P., Cozot R. and Bouatouch K. (2016). Shape and Reflectance from RGB-D Images using Time Sequential Illumination . In Proceedings of the 11th Joint Conference on Computer Vision, Imaging and Computer Graphics Theory and Applications - Volume 3: VISAPP, (VISIGRAPP 2016) ISBN 978-989-758-175-5, pages 532-541. DOI: 10.5220/0005726305320541

in Bibtex Style

author={Matis Hudon and Adrien Gruson and Paul Kerbiriou and Rémi Cozot and Kadi Bouatouch},
title={Shape and Reflectance from RGB-D Images using Time Sequential Illumination},
booktitle={Proceedings of the 11th Joint Conference on Computer Vision, Imaging and Computer Graphics Theory and Applications - Volume 3: VISAPP, (VISIGRAPP 2016)},

in EndNote Style

JO - Proceedings of the 11th Joint Conference on Computer Vision, Imaging and Computer Graphics Theory and Applications - Volume 3: VISAPP, (VISIGRAPP 2016)
TI - Shape and Reflectance from RGB-D Images using Time Sequential Illumination
SN - 978-989-758-175-5
AU - Hudon M.
AU - Gruson A.
AU - Kerbiriou P.
AU - Cozot R.
AU - Bouatouch K.
PY - 2016
SP - 532
EP - 541
DO - 10.5220/0005726305320541